Explanatory Note
Re: By-law Number 6738-25
By-law Number 6738-25 has the following purpose and effect:
To amend By-law Number 6000-17, as amended, the Zoning By-law in effect in the Town
of Aurora, to rezone the subject lands from “Promenade Downtown (PD1) Exception
Zone (59)” to “Promenade Downtown (PD1) Exception Zone (571)”.
The effect of this zoning amendment will rezone the subject property to one common
exception zone category; and will facilitate the creation of thirteen more apartment
dwelling units than previously permitted by the “Promenade Downtown (PD1) Exception
Zone (59)”.
